Abstract

Blood samples from healthy and unrelated individuals (n=135–150) were extracted by Chelex 100 procedure (1). DNA samples (5–25 ng) were amplified in a “PCR sprint” (Hybaid) thermal cycler and typed-classified according to the DNA commission of the ISFH (2). Allele and genotype frequencies were determined and Hardy-Weinberg equilibrium was tested by aX2 method. From the genotype data, the power of discrimination (PD) according to the equation suggested by Fisher (3) was calculated. The heterozigosity value (OH) as described by Nei and Roychoudhury (4) was determined.
